Comber Real Estate Market

A wonderful mix of antique and newly built single-family homes give Comber real estate a more unique feel than your average small town. While many homes for sale in Comber have certain similarities, such as brick or vinyl exteriors and side driveways, you'll notice that no two homes are exactly alike. By combining a number of different traditional architectural styles, have plenty of designs to choose from.

Several homes also back onto large farms and grassy fields, giving owners an unobstructed view of the vast valley and easy access to scenic walking areas. But whether you live near an open field or not, nearly all Comber residents can enjoy a unique view of windmills from their yards thanks to the 72-turbine, 166 megawatt Comber Wind Farm that was built in 2012.

Comber Community Amenities

Even though Comber is only a 15-minute drive from Lakeshore's town centre and the scenic shorelines of Lake St. Clair, it has an abundance of amenities right in town for residents to enjoy.

Businesses in the community include a Royal Canadian Legion, Tim Hortons, supermarket, post office, pharmacy, and multiple banks, auto repair shops, convenience stores, and restaurants.

For family fun and entertainment, the Comber Fair has been going strong every year since it began way back in 1860. The fair showcases country living and Comber's strong history of agriculture, with antique farm equipment on display, as well as several events and activities to enjoy:

  • Lawnmower Racing
  • Demolition Derby
  • Pickup Truck Tug-of-War
  • Kid's Rides
  • Beer Garden
  • Johnny Cash Tribute Band

Comber School Information

Centennial Central Public School serves students in the neighbourhood from Kindergarten to Grade 8. This school has about 240 students and includes a variety of music and sports programs. Upon graduation, students can then choose between Belle River District High School and Tilbury District High School, both of which are about 10 to 15 minutes away by car.
